5 itemsAbout the Game
Dark Compass is a multi-chapter psychological horror game centered around exploration.
You will experience interconnected yet standalone journeys, delving into fear, choice, and obsession on the threshold between life and death.

Game Features
• Segmented Adventures: Short, intense psychological horror episodes, distinct yet secretly interconnected.
• Experimental Narrative: A unique blend of gameplay mechanics and storytelling designed to deliver an unsettling psychological horror experience.
• Retro Aesthetic: Nostalgic visuals inspired by VHS, Dither, and pixel art.
